In recent years, the rise of decentralized finance (DeFi) has revolutionized the financial landscape, offering users innovative ways to trade, invest, and manage their digital assets. Among the standout platforms in this arena is raydium swap, a decentralized exchange that facilitates seamless token swaps on the Solana blockchain. This article delves into the intricacies of Raydium Swap, examining its technological framework, financial implications, and broader cultural significance in today’s fast-evolving digital economy.
Raydium Swap operates as an automated market maker (AMM) that provides liquidity for Solana-based tokens. Unlike traditional exchanges that rely on order books, Raydium uses liquidity pools to enable users to swap tokens instantly and at competitive rates. This mechanism not only enhances trading efficiency but also empowers users to earn rewards through liquidity provision.
